127.0.0.1 is the loopback address of your computer.
I think the affending line is put in by ZA, Google Web Accelerator,
and other products for pop-up blocking, ad blocking, and maybe other things.
Supposedly the end result and affect is benign.
(since it's a loopback to your own computer, I'm pretty sure nothing is
being sent anywhere, so it's not a way to trojan, or grab info via spyware,
or anything like that -- anyone disagree?)
